In pasture, c. 50m SW of well and on W side of field fence. Low, roughly oval mound of burnt material (14.4m NNW-SSE; 13.7m ENE-WSW; H 0.3m). Surface of mound has several depressions. Burnt material incorporated into adjacent field fence.
The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Cork. Volume 4: North Cork'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 2000). In certain instances the entries have been revised and updated in the light of recent research.
